Is There Dairy In International Delight Creamer?

No, international delight creamers do not contain lactose However, they do contain sodium caseinate, a milk derivative. Is International Delight nondairy? International Delight remains a lactose-free non-dairy creamer today. Where Are De’Longhi Appliances Made?

Its acquisition of the British appliance maker Kenwood for £45.9 million (about $66.7 million) in 2001 gave it access to Kenwood’s Chinese factory. As a result, many of De’Longhi’s products are now imported from China, while design and engineering remain largely in Italy Are DeLonghi products made in China? What Is The Difference Between Instant And Classic Coffee?

regular coffee is roasted and ground coffee beans which are the seeds of the coffee tree. But instant coffee is made by a short, brewing process from the regular coffee by dehydrating the same and leaving a powder which is rehydrated to make coffee Regular coffee typically tastes much better than instant coffee.
